That's the best representation of the speed, power and excitement of skiing I've ever seen. Huge props to @MarcusBrown.

 

But I just want to push back a bit on the idea that it's mostly skiing's fault we aren't on TV anymore. Could we present a better show? Absolutely. But the biggest reason we aren't on TV anymore is that ESPN no longer needs inexpensive programming like it did in the 80s and early 90s. It now has enough money to secure the broadcast rights to the biggest sporting events in the world (Monday Night Football, NBA Finals, etc.), pushing out sports like skiing, beach volleyball and arm wrestling.

 

All is not rosy in the sport, but I think it is self defeating to paint a picture bleaker than it is. Not saying Marcus is the only one doing this, it's a trap we all fall into sometimes. Marcus, more than anyone else, is trying to do something about it.

That's right. In fact you can buy a 22-minute show on Outside for roughly $10,000. That doesn't include production costs.

 

The difference is that before we didn't have to pay, or were possibly even paid to be on TV, now we have to pay to play. The media landscape has changed on us.
